The 12.6 update focused on streamlining data management through several UI and functional improvements:

Redesigned Data Recovery Interface: All detected logical drives and devices are now organized under two clear tabs for easier navigation.

Hover-to-Scan: A new "Scan" button appears automatically when you hover over a target drive or device.

FAT32 Data Recovery: Enhanced accuracy when scanning for lost or deleted pictures, videos, and files on FAT32-formatted drives, such as USB sticks and memory cards.

Integrated Recovery Results: The "Recovery Result" section was moved to the bottom of the "Specific Location" tab for better visibility.

Windows 11 Compatibility: Fully optimized for use with Windows 11 systems. Free vs. Pro Features

Key Features of MiniTool Partition Wizard 12.6

MiniTool Partition Wizard 12.6 provides a suite of tools that go beyond the capabilities of the built-in Windows Disk Management utility. Disk and Partition Management

Resize and Move Partitions: Easily expand or shrink volumes without losing data.

Merge and Split Partitions: Combine two partitions into one or divide a large drive into smaller segments.

Format and Wipe: Securely clear data or change file systems (NTFS, FAT32, exFAT).

Convert Disk Types: Switch between MBR and GPT or Dynamic and Basic disks.
